#AIExclusive: Tasteful textures and coy colours add a European touch to this Kanpur home

Designed by Woodcraft International’s Rajiv Sethi and Kavya Sethi for a family of 3 members in Kanpur. The ‘Fluted Home’ is spread over 2,500 sq ft and brings together an interplay of European style with minimal colors.

The brief caters to two bedrooms, living & dining, and a kitchen. The designers believe neutral tones are one of the best ways to keep the home looking tasteful and elegant. This home dwells in the tones of browns, whites, and beiges with gold & pastel green accents.

Easily European

The space is designed in such a way with neutral-toned walls, and the interplay of textures, arts, and lights. Moving around the space, Ganesh Ji is placed exactly at the entrance and rests on a classic black & mapa console along with the moulding, mirror and ceramics details on the wall besides. A double-height sky lit living room makes a catchy entrance foyer. Taking a hint from the Europeans, mouldings are used in the living room, dining room, and bedrooms. The kitchen blends in the tone of beige with white mosaic accent tiles.

Adding accents

White wooden panel doors, seamless Italian flooring, off white walls and off white & ash-wood furniture. An accent wine chair and rug is added in the living room to bring in the vibrancy to the entire space. A set of black & white chairs along with a classic black chandelier are placed in the sky light area along with a beautiful Mandir.

Utmost attention is paid to all the details. There is a sense of togetherness and warmth that comes with this hue making it ideal for relaxation. The dining space has a huge sage green wall with black & grey bar unit and dining chairs made in shade of tan with ash wood legs complimenting the entire space.

Nesting in warmth

The master bedroom & the daughter’s bedroom are kept neutral toned. Colours are added through the mode of soft furnishings and pastel green accent chairs. We opted for coloured subway tiles in both the washrooms and teakwood vanities.

To add a little bit of texture, wallpapers are used in the backdrop and broad daylight makes the space look warmer and bigger. A lot of vibrancy is added through the medium of curtains, carpets, artwork, and plants.

About the design firm:

Woodcraft International is a New Delhi based multi–disciplinary design and architectural firm constituted, in 1991, by Mr. Rajiv Sethi and now his architect daughter, Ms. Kavya Sethi is carrying forward the legacy. Ms. Kavya Sethi is a prolific architect, having an experience of over 7 years in designing various residential and commercial projects. She’s carrying forward the 30 year old endowments of WCI in the field of architecture and interiors with her new ideas. Amalgamation of age old traditions and modern ideas. Woodcraft International is a professionally managed company which has been in the field of Architecture, Interior Design, Turnkey Projects, Project management.
